As for me and the teen session: 

I had a good time!  Met 9 other lymies and exchanged contact info.  The lady that was in charge of the teen session was very nice and would bring up a subject, like coping mechanisms, and just ask us to share ideas and experiences if we wanted.  She didn't do the whole normal speech "This Is Lyme Disease".  Because she knew the majority of us already knew what the disease is, and have been through treatment.  She encouraged us to share, but it was not a requirement.  There was a break midway where we ate some snacks.  The last activity was to cut out pictures, words, etc. out of magazines and make any kind of collage we wanted.  Just as an activity to get our minds working/express ourselves.  We were given free range of what we cut out and pasted into journals provided.  It was an overall good experience.

4 hours to get there and 4 hours back, so I was exhausted afterwards.  Slept in late today, but the good time I had outweighs the side effects of going.

Hi everyone!  

 I am glad we went to the conference and thankful that CALDA decided to have the event.  It was great to meet LupnerRN in person and share info.  There were a lot of people at the conf., more than we expected.  I wish there had been more time to actually talk and share insights with other lymies, and an easy way to connect with people from your own geographic area. (This is not the fault of the conference, I'm just a little shy at times!)  The speakers were reputable and did a good job. There was a lot of general info. covered which would have been useful to "new lymies", and there was also some "scientific" type info that would be more useful to "well read" lymies.  The speakers had to move fairly quickly through their material, so it was hard to take complete notes.  My personal opinion is that the question/answer session at the end of the day was also very valuable and needed to be longer.  It was obvious that the crowd had a lot of questions and were able to articulate what they really wanted to know from these experts.  It would be great if there was a way for the speakers to know, ahead of time, what it is that the attendees really want addressed.  So, I guess it is fair to say that it was a good conference, but there is room for improvement.  I would still want to go again if they have another one.  I think the material presented will be available by email to those that attended.  I plan to try and get the copies.
